Hi! Last year I graduated from the University of Cambridge with a double first class BA in Physical Natural Sciences and I am now a full-time tutor in Maths, Physics and Chemistry. I have three years of part-time tutoring experience to students of all abilities from ages 6 to 20.
I offer tutoring in:
- Chemistry (up to A-level)
- Maths (up to 1st year university)
- Physics (up to 2nd year university)
- Oxbridge interview preparation
My teaching methods are flexible, and I will tailor them to the student. However, I find that going through the syllabus and ensuring that the student has a good understanding of everything is a good place to start. I can then move on to practice questions, past papers, and exam technique.
Although my approach to teaching is quite systematic, with good exam results being the ultimate goal, I also find that appreciating why science is relevant to the real world helps motivate students and boosts their confidence. I therefore like to help my students understand *why* it is important to learn this stuff.
I am available during the day and evenings, seven days a week.
I teach in Kew, Richmond and all surrounding areas.
